HUM 2450 - Humanities in the Americas (Credit Hours: 3)

College Credit 01 - Lower Level Arts & Profession

Description

This course is designed to be an introduction to the cultural forms, and practices of the different peoples and communities that make up the Americas, including North, Central, and South America, and the Caribbean through analysis and investigation of philosophy, art, architecture, literature and/or other cultural expressions. This course fulfills the Gordon Rule writing requirement and must be completed with a grade of C or higher pursuant to State Board of Education Rule 6A-10.030.
